Abstract
Flash vacuum pyrolysis of (1-isonaphthofuryl) methyl benzoate (6) at temperatures in the range 550–700° C and ca. 10− 2 torr gave methylenenaphthocyclobutenone (13), 3-ethynyl- 2-naphthaldehyde (14) and naphthocyclopentadienone (15). The mechanism for the formation of 13–15 is proposed to involve double migrations of the benzoate group into the isonaphthofuran ring.
